Altimetry refers to the measurement of altitude or elevation above sea level. There are several synonyms for this word, which can be used interchangeably depending on the context. Some of these synonyms include altitude measurement, height measurement, elevation reading, elevation measurement, and altitude calculation. These terms are commonly used in fields such as geology, aviation, and oceanography, where precise measurement of altitude is necessary for various purposes. Whether it is measuring the height of a mountain or the depth of the ocean, altimetry provides essential information for researchers, scientists, and engineers.
